Most remote village has the cleanest air
By Terry Kirby Chief Reporter
The
good news is that villagers enjoy the cleanest air in England and are
surrounded by wildlife, unspoilt forest and rolling green hills... The
bad news is that shopping involves a 100-mile round trip.
That is life for the 200 or so people
in the village of Kielder, Northumberland, which was named yesterday as
probably the least polluted place in England.
The vilalge is in Kielder Forest
Park, which comprises 60,000 hectares of planted forest and Kielder
Water, the largest man-made lake in western Europe. Near the border with
Scotland, it is home to England's largest colony of red squirrels, herds
of deers and scarce birds.
Kielder was named the least polluted
area in England by Country Life Magazine, which assessed the impact of
air, noise and light pollution. It found that more than 90 per cent of
England was affected by pollution and that only the most rural areas,
such as Northumberland, were relatively pollution-free. There had been a
big increase in air, noise and light pollution in the past decade.
London and the South-east were the worst hit with Birmingham, Liverpool,
Manchester and Sheffield also badly contaminated.
Only one tenth of the country now
experiences a truly dark night after light pollution rose by a quarter
between 1993 and 2000. An increase in street lamps, floodlights at
sports venues and security lights at private homes has been blamed.
